Output 7d394969452d83e1c510825699de0ed4a116bd031bd3c8a4efa015ddc7d89796:5

value
833600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f866d664e621ad165c22e2586a2c367d5b82f57b OP_EQUAL
address
3QLShPd9PRNuTLWkkq31iG2p4SxKWNjAVf
transaction
7d394969452d83e1c510825699de0ed4a116bd031bd3c8a4efa015ddc7d89796
spent
true